Kinds Of Glass Repairs

Glass repair incorporates numerous kinds of damage and materials. Below is a table outlining common types of glass used for repair and their associated repair approaches.

Glass TypeCommon UsesRepair MethodsWhen to Consider Replacement
Tempered GlassShower doors, table topsChip repair, polishingBig cracks, substantial damage
Laminated GlassWindscreens, skylightsResin injection, film applicationSignificant visibility issues
Annealed GlassWindows, glass doorsScratch repair, sealingCracks longer than 1 inch
Plexiglass (Acrylic)Displays, signsHeat bending, adhesive bondingUV damage, serious scratches
Double GlazedInsulated windowsSeal replacement, glazingMisting, broken seal, condensation

When to Repair or Replace Glass

Deciding to repair or change glass can typically be challenging. Here are some standards to assist determine the best course of action:

Signs You Should Repair Glass

  1. Minor Chips and Cracks: Small, non-structural chips and cracks can typically be repaired efficiently without jeopardizing glass integrity.
  2. Aesthetic Surface Damage: Scratches that do not penetrate through the glass can typically be polished out or filled.
  3. Laminated Glass Damage: If the external layer is harmed however the inner layers stay undamaged, repair might be possible.

Signs You Should Replace Glass

  1. Big Cracks: If the crack is longer than 6 inches or spans across susceptible locations, replacement is frequently the best choice.
  2. Structural Integrity Compromise: For tempered glass, any substantial damage can compromise security, requiring immediate replacement.
  3. Foggy Double Glazed Units: When condensation kinds in between panes, suggesting a broken seal, replacement is normally needed.
  4. Extreme Weather Damage: If glass has sustained considerable damage from hail, high winds, or other weather situations, think about changing it.

The Glass Repair Process

The glass repair process differs depending upon the type of damage and the glass's attributes. Here's a step-by-step overview of the normal glass repair process:

Step 1: Assessment

A professional need to assess the degree of damage to determine whether repair or replacement is feasible. This includes taking a look at the glass and the surrounding structure.

Step 2: Cleaning

Before any repair, the glass must be cleaned up completely to eliminate dirt, dust, and particles. This step is crucial for reliable bonding and making sure a smooth surface.

Step 3: Application of Repair Material

For small chips and fractures, a resin is injected into the damaged area. For scratches, polishing representatives or fillers might be made use of. It's essential for this material to cure appropriately for maximum efficiency.

Step 4: Finishing Touches

After the repair material has actually cured, any excess resin is trimmed, and the location is polished for a seamless surface.

Step 5: Final Inspection

A comprehensive examination needs to be performed after the repair procedure to guarantee that the damage is effectively attended to and the glass is safe for usage.

Step 6: Maintenance Tips

Once the glass is fixed, follow upkeep pointers to safeguard against future damage. This consists of routine cleaning, avoiding abrupt temperature level changes, and bewaring throughout extreme weather.

Regularly Asked Questions

1. How much does glass repair generally cost?

The cost of glass repair can vary significantly based upon the type of glass, degree of damage, and labor costs. Minor repairs can range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150, while more extensive repairs or replacements can surpass ₤ 300.

2. Is it safe to repair glass myself?

While small repairs can in some cases be dealt with by property owners, it's usually recommended to seek professional aid, specifically for structural glass. Incorrect repairs can result in safety threats or further damage.

3. How long does glass repair take?

The duration of glass repair depends upon the type and extent of damage. Small repairs can take as little as 30 minutes, while extensive repairs may need a number of hours and extra curing time.

4. Will repaired glass be as strong as it was originally?

In lots of cases, appropriately fixed glass can restore structural stability, however it may not be as strong as it initially was. This is especially true for tempered glass, which is created to shatter in specific ways to decrease injury threat.

5. What kinds of damage can be repaired?
